Facts and Events
Name Mary Elizabeth Ross
Alt Name Elizabeth Ross
Married Name Elizabeth Ross Trammell
Married Name Mary Elizabeth Ross Trammell
Gender Female
Birth? 5 Feb 1920 Rome, Floyd, Georgia, United States
Marriage 23 Jul 1934 Dalton, Whitfield, Georgia, United Statesto George Clinton Trammell, Jr
Death? 6 May 1987 Rome, Floyd, Georgia, United States
Burial? 8 May 1987 East View Cemetery, Rome, Floyd, Georgia, United States

  1.   1930 Census of Floyd, Georgia, United States
    11 Apr 1930.

    State Georgia, County Floyd, Rome city, Fourth Ward. Enumeration District No. 58-12, Supervisor's District No. One, Sheet 11A. Enumerated 11 April 1930.

    305 West Fifth Street, Dwelling 191, Household 247.

    7-Ross, Chas B. Head. Own home worth $3,500. Own a radio set. Not on a farm. Male. White. Age 56. Married (at age 23). Not in school; can read and write. Born in Georgia; father born in Georgia; mother born in Alabama. Machinist, silk mill. Not at work on last regular working day. Not a veteran.

    8-[Ross], Gertrude. Wife. Female. White. Age 49. Married (at age 16). Not in school; can read and write. Born in Georgia; parents born in Georgia.

    9-[Ross], Jessie. Daughter. Female. White. Age 32. Single. Not in school; can read and write. Born in Georgia; parents born in Georgia. Bookkeeper, silk mill. At work on last regular working day.

    10-[Ross], Sara. Daughter. Female. White. Age 24. Single. Not in school; can read and write. Born in Georgia; parents born in Georgia. Chemist, silk mill. At work on last regular working day.

    11-[Ross], Ben. Son. Male. White. Age 18. Single. In school; can read and write. Born in Georgia; parents born in Georgia.

    12-[Ross], Lewis. Son. Male. White. Age 16. Single. In school; can read and write. Born in Georgia; parents born in Georgia.

    13-[Ross], Lamar. Son. Male. White. Age 13. Single. In school; can read and write. Born in Georgia; parents born in Georgia.

    14-[Ross], Elizabeth. Daughter. Female. White. Age 10. Single. In school; can read and write. Born in Georgia; parents born in Georgia.

    15-[Ross], Virginia. Daughter. Female. White. Age 6. Single. In school.

  2.   Mrs. Mary Elizabeth Ross Trammell, 67, of Pembroke Place, died Wednesday at 4:20 pm at a Rome hospital following an extended illness.
           Mrs. Trammell was born in Floyd County, February 5, 1920, daughter of the late Charley Boyd Ross and Katie Gertrude Simmons Ross. She had been a resident of Floyd County all her life and was a member of North Rome United Methodist Church. Prior to retirement, she was employed by Celanese Fibers Corporation for a number of years.
           Survivors include her husband, George Clinton Trammell Jr, to whom she was married July 23, 1934; a son, George Clinton (Pat) Trammell III of Rome; three daughters, Mrs. Mary Carol Griffin, Mrs. Connie Ross Shaw and Mrs. Ellen Olivia Mathis, all of Rome; a sister, Mrs. Virginia Hardin of Harlingen, Texas; a brother Lamar (Doc) Ross of Rome; 12 grandchildren and five great-grandchildren; a number of nieces and nephews.
           Funeral services will be held Friday at 3 pm in North Rome United Methodist Church with the Revs. Leland Bagwell and Charles Nicklaus officiating. Interment will be in East View Cemetery. The body will be placed in the church on Friday at 2 pm to lie in state prior to the service hours.
           All pallbearers are asked to assemble at the church at 2:45 pm Friday and will include the following gentlemen: Clint Trammell IV, Boyd Trammell, Kurt Trammell, Phil Trammell, Charles Griffin Jr, Dayton Shaw, Dan Mathis and Ed Earle. The honorary escort will be comprised of Delmas Franklin Sr, Jimmy Johnson, Stanley Payne, Broadus Coker and Wilson Cook.
           The family will receive friends tonight from 7 until 9 pm at the Jennings Funeral Home and at other hours may be contacted at the residence of the son, 10 Dell Place. (Jennings Funeral Home) [Rome News-Tribune, May 1987] KF-in-Georgia
